Alcohol testing determines the presence and concentration of ethanol in the body. It's critical for preventing accidents and ensuring compliance with various regulations in Providence, Kentucky. Various testing methods, including breath, urine, blood, and saliva tests, are deployed based on situational needs.
Alcohol Testing is used in many settings
Common Methods of Alcohol Testing
Blood tests - Used to measure precise blood alcohol content.
Breathalyzers - Convenient for roadside law enforcement checks.
Urine tests - Indicative of longer-term use.
Saliva tests - Useful for quick screening in various settings.

Drug-related statistics specific to Providence, Kentucky, can be challenging to find due to its small size, but looking at broader trends in Webster County or Kentucky as a whole can provide context. Generally, Kentucky faces significant issues with substance abuse, particularly opioids, which have impacted many communities statewide.
According to reports, Kentucky has higher-than-average rates of drug overdoses and related fatalities, reflecting a critical need for effective drug prevention and testing programs. Efforts in youth education, community workshops, and partnerships with healthcare providers are ongoing to address these concerns and mitigate the impacts of drugs on local communities.
